diff --git a/kjvstudy_org/templates/accessibility.html b/kjvstudy_org/templates/accessibility.html index 9080717..09b0a98 100644 --- a/kjvstudy_org/templates/accessibility.html +++ b/kjvstudy_org/templates/accessibility.html @@ -183,13 +183,21 @@ - + [ Previous verse - + ] Next verse + + + Go back + + + + Next verse (alternative) + Space Read selected text aloud (press again to stop) diff --git a/kjvstudy_org/templates/verse.html b/kjvstudy_org/templates/verse.html index 147c881..28fd61e 100644 --- a/kjvstudy_org/templates/verse.html +++ b/kjvstudy_org/templates/verse.html @@ -1220,6 +1220,18 @@ {% if verse_num < total_verses %} window.location.href = '/book/{{ book }}/chapter/{{ chapter }}/verse/{{ verse_num + 1 }}'; {% endif %} + } else if (e.key === '[') { + // Previous verse + e.preventDefault(); + {% if verse_num > 1 %} + window.location.href = '/book/{{ book }}/chapter/{{ chapter }}/verse/{{ verse_num - 1 }}'; + {% endif %} + } else if (e.key === ']') { + // Next verse + e.preventDefault(); + {% if verse_num < total_verses %} + window.location.href = '/book/{{ book }}/chapter/{{ chapter }}/verse/{{ verse_num + 1 }}'; + {% endif %} } }); })();